Shape scanning at the push of a button

The optical scanner SCAN3D acquires a series of 3D measurements from different directions automatically (2 or 5 axes are available). Measurement is based on the fringe projection principle. The resulting shape data are available in common triangle mesh formats. Because of its usability it is perfectly suited for applications in:

  - Reverse engineering

  - Medical engineering

  - Measuring works of art

  - Mold making


 
Software

Fine registration ensures that the 3D scans are precisely aligned with each other. The 3D measurements are converted into triangle meshes and cleaned of noise, aliasing and outlier points. Next, the meshes for the different views are merged into a single surface description. Finally, any gaps that are present are closed using interpolation in a fully automated process, and a curvature-dependent mesh thinning is carried out.
The software offers users various display, evaluation and editing options.

Measurement Principle

SCAN3D is an optical sensor based on coded illumination. Measurement is based on a patented process that involves illuminating the surface of the measured object with a fringe pattern. A camera observes the illuminated object from the side. The surface shape of the object is calculated according to the resulting displacement of the fringes.
